Claim Rejections - 35 USC § 101
35 U.S.C. 101 reads as follows:
Whoever invents or discovers any new and useful process, machine, manufacture, or composition of matter, or any new and useful improvement thereof, may obtain a patent therefor, subject to the conditions and requirements of this title.
Claims 4-7 and 9 are rejected under 35 U.S.C. 101 because the claimed invention is directed to product of nature without significantly more. This judicial exception is not integrated into a practical application and the claims do not include additional elements that are sufficient to amount to significantly more than the judicial exception for the reasons set forth below.
35 U.S.C. § 101 requires that to be patent-eligible, an invention (1) must be directed to one of the four statutory categories, and (2) must not be wholly directed to subject matter encompassing a judicially recognized exception. M.P.E.P. § 2106. Regarding judicial exceptions, “[p]henomena of nature, though just discovered, mental processes, and abstract intellectual concepts are not patentable, as they are the basic tools of scientific and technological work.” Gottschalk v. Benson, 409 U.S. 63, 67 (1972); see also M.P.E.P. § 2106, part II.
The unpatentability of natural products was confirmed by the U.S. Supreme Court in Association for Molecular Pathology v. Myriad Genetics, Inc., , 133 S. Ct. 2107, 2116, (2013).
Claims Analysis:
As set forth in MPEP 2106, the claims have been analyzed to determine whether they are directed to one of the four statutory categories (STEP 1). The claims were then analyzed to determine if they recite a judicial exception (JE) (STEP 2A, prong 1) [Mayo Collaborative Services v. Prometheus Labs., Inc., 132 S. Ct. 1289, 1293 (2012), Alice Corp. Pry. Ltd. v. CLS Bank Int'l, 134 S. Ct. 2347 (2014)]. The claims were then analyzed to determine whether they recite an element or step that integrates the JE into a practical application (STEP 2A, prong 2) [Vanda Pharmaceuticals Inc., v. West-Ward Pharmaceuticals, 887 F.3d 1117 (Fed. Cir. 2018)]. In the absence of a step(s) or element(s) that integrate the JE into a practical application, the additional elements/steps have been considered to determine whether they add significantly more to the JE (STEP 2B) [Mayo Collaborative Services v. Prometheus Labs., Inc., 132 S. Ct. 1289, 1293 (2012), Alice Corp. Pry. Ltd. v. CLS Bank Int'l, 134 S. Ct. 2347 (2014)]. It was found that the present claims fail to meet the elements required for patent eligibility.
The claims are directed to kits comprising nucleic acid sequences, as such the claims are directed to products. Accordingly, the claims are directed to one of the four statutory categories of invention.
The claims are drawn to substances for detecting gene expression of particular genes, to include nucleic acid primers and nucleic acid probes, as well as SEQ ID NOS: 1-46. However, these sequences are identical to sequences within the gene sequence they target, which are naturally occurring sequences. As such the claims are directed to a product of nature which is a judicial exception.
This judicial exception is not integrated into a practical application because the nucleic acid molecules encompassed by the claims convey the same genetic information as their naturally occurring counterparts. The Supreme Court has made clear "separating [DNA] from surrounding genetic material is not an act of invention" Myriad, 133 S. Ct. at 2117. In Myriad v. Ambry CAFC 2014-1361,1366, December 17, 2014, the CAFC further (regarding a claim directed to a pair of primers) stated “In fact, the naturally occurring genetic sequences at issue here do not perform a significantly new function. Rather, the naturally occurring material is used to form the first step in a chain reaction—a function that is performed because the primer maintains the exact same nucleotide sequence as the relevant portion of the naturally occurring sequence. One of the primary functions of DNA’s structure in nature is that complementary nucleotide sequences bind to each other. It is this same function that is exploited here—the primer binds to its complementary nucleotide sequence. Thus, just as in nature, primers utilize the innate ability of DNA to bind to itself.”
Although the claim recites a “kit”, these elements do not add meaningful limitations to the claims as they are merely nominal or token extra solution activity and are nothing more than an attempt to generally link the product of nature into a particular technological environment. Furthermore, these limitations do not change the structures of the encompassed natural products. None of these molecules or cells are patent eligible, whether isolated or not, pursuant to the Supreme Court decision in Association for Molecular Pathology v. Myriad Genetics Inc., US (June 13, 2013).
Accordingly, the claims are rejected as being directed to non-patentable subject matter.
Claim Rejections - 35 USC § 112
112(b)
The following is a quotation of 35 U.S.C. 112(b):
(b) CONCLUSION.—The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the inventor or a joint inventor regards as the invention.
Claims 4-7, and 9 are rejected under 35 U.S.C. 112(b) as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or regards as the invention.
The claims recite “a substance” capable of measuring the expression levels of certain genes. While some claims refer to the “substance” as a primer and probe set, the term is confusing because it appears to refer to a single molecule that can be used to measure the expression levels of the recited genes. While this appears to be a result of translation from a foreign language, it is suggested that the claims be amended to recite a “nucleic acid primer and nucleic acid probe set”.
Claims 6 and 9 refer to SEQ ID NOS however neither the specification nor the claims refer to any particular SEQ ID NO.
The use of the term “preferably” in claim 9 is indefinite because it is not clear if the limitations following the term are required by the claims or not.
The use of the phrase “set forth in” is indefinite because it is not clear what portion of any particular sequence is encompassed by the phrase. For example, does it refer to a sequence that ‘consists” of the SEQ ID NO, or does it refer to any shorter sequence from “in” the SEQ ID NOS.
Claim Rejections - 35 USC § 102
The following is a quotation of the appropriate paragraphs of 35 U.S.C. 102 that form the basis for the rejections under this section made in this Office action:
A person shall be entitled to a patent unless –
(a)(1) the claimed invention was patented, described in a printed publication, or in public use, on sale, or otherwise available to the public before the effective filing date of the claimed invention.
Claims 4-7 and 9 are rejected under 35 U.S.C. 102(a)(1) as being anticipated by NEB catalog (1998/1999), pp. 121, 284.
The NEB catalog offered for sale a random primer mix of 6, 9, 12 and 24 mer primers. As the calculation below shows, about 3.2 x 108 molecules of every single 12-mer are present in each tube of 12 mer nucleotides. No calculation is provided for the 6 or 9 mers as they will necessarily contain more of every n-mer than that calculated for the 12 mer. With regard to the 24mers, about 9 molecules of every 24 mer are statistically expected to be present in each tube,
a. Molecular weight of 12-mer:
12 x 325 daltons/nucleotide = 3,900 daltons = 3,900 g/mol
b. Total number of possible 12-mers:
412 = 1.6 x 107 molecules
c. How many molecules of 12-mer in a vial sold by NEB:
1 A260 unit = 33 mg = 3.3 x 10-5 g
3.3 x 10-5 g / 3,900 g/mol = 8.4 x 10-9 mol
(8.4 x 10-9 mol) x (6.02 x 1023 molecules/mol) = 5 x 1015 molecules
d. How many molecules of each 12-mer in a single vial:
5 x1015 molecules / 1.6 x 107 molecules = 3.2 x 108 molecules of each 12-mer per vial
e. Molecular weight of 24-mer:
24 x 325 daltons/nucleotide = 7,800 daltons = 7,800 g/mol
f. Total number of possible 24-mers:
424 = 2.8 x 1014 molecules
g. How many molecules of 24-mer in a vial sold by NEB:
1 A260 unit = 33 mg = 3.3 x 10-5 g
3.3 x 10-5 g / 7,800 g/mol = 4.2 x 10-9 mol
(4.2 x 10-9 mol) x (6.02 x 1023 molecules/mol) = 2.5 x 1015 molecules
h. How many molecules of each 24-mer in a single vial:
2.5 x1015 molecules / 2.8 x 1014 molecules = 9 molecules/vial
With regard to claims 4 and 7, the term “substance” broadly encompasses the buffer in the vials. With regard to claims 4, 5, and 7, these claims also encompass a very large genus of possible nucleic acids with no particular base composition or length. The NEB catalog vials will inherently and necessarily contain 6, 9, 12 and 24 nucleotide containing molecules encompassed by the broad recitation in claims. Although claims 5 and 7 recite a “primer and probe set”, the definition of “probe” in the specification (page 10, first para) does not distinguish it from a primer or any other single stranded nucleic acid molecule. With regard to claims 6 and 9, the kits taught by NEB necessarily contain molecules “set forth in” any SEQ ID NO.
